Average Real Estate Sales Agents Salary in Atlantic City-Hammonton, NJ

The average salary for a Real Estate Sales Agents in Atlantic City-Hammonton, NJ is $74,400. This compensation is in line with national standards, reflecting a balanced and stable local job market.

Real Estate Sales Agents Salary Distribution in Atlantic City-Hammonton, NJ

The earning potential for Real Estate Sales Agentss in Atlantic City-Hammonton, NJ varies significantly by experience level. There is a substantial income gap, with top earners (90th percentile) making over 3.6x the starting salary. This indicates strong career progression opportunities. Entry-level roles (10th percentile) typically start around $36,940, while highly experienced professionals can command wages upwards of $133,290.

At 0.43x, Atlantic City-Hammonton, NJ has a notably lower concentration of Real Estate Sales Agents jobs than the national average. Opportunities in this area are relatively scarce for this profession.

90 people work as Real Estate Sales Agents in Atlantic City-Hammonton, NJ.

Only 0.537 out of every 1,000 local jobs are Real Estate Sales Agents roles — this is a niche profession in the area.

How much does a Real Estate Sales Agents make in Atlantic City-Hammonton, NJ?

The median annual salary for a Real Estate Sales Agents in Atlantic City-Hammonton, NJ is $74,400. This typically ranges from $36,940 for entry-level positions to $133,290 for top-level roles.

How does the salary compare to the national average?

The average salary for this role in Atlantic City-Hammonton, NJ is 5.7% higher than the national median of $70,360.

Methodology: Salary data is derived from the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S) OEWS 2024 release. Figures represent gross pay before taxes. Analysis includes 90 employees in the Atlantic City-Hammonton, NJ area with a job density of 0.537 per 1,000 jobs. Cost of Living data is estimated based on state and metro averages.
